Mark Singleton was played by Robin Thomas and was on from March 83 till January 85.

He married Stacey,Cass' sister in Dec 83 but it only lasted 6 months.I think he had a brief back burner romance with Alice Matthews Frame.

When he was introduced he was a congressman who had a past affair with Stacey,who was involved with Jamie Frame.His wife Janet came to town.

When he was injured Stacey married him.They had a daughter Megan.Father and daughter were killed off when Stacey returned few years later.
